吉林工商学院-博学善思

 找回密码
 立即注册
搜索
热搜: 活动 交友 discuz
查看: 1264|回复: 0

?【内推】【社招】百度-部门直招进度可查-数仓-后端-前端-SRE

[复制链接]

6

主题

6

帖子

34

积分

新手上路

Rank: 1

积分
34
发表于 2020-9-18 11:32:39 | 显示全部楼层 |阅读模式
我们是百度工程效能部,部门主要做DevOps基础设施(如项目管理、代码托管、CI/CD)、分布式编译系统等,提供互联网产品研发的项目管理、代码协同、分布式编译、DevOps的全套云端解决方案,产品形态可参考 cloud.baidu.com/product/xly.html

部门直招,HC充足,进度可查,简历请发至 wkun@bupt.edu.cn ,邮件标题辛苦标明:意向岗位+姓名+手机号

岗位JD序号如下,感兴趣就看下去吧~
(0)数据开发工程师
(1)Java研发工程师
(2)Web前端研发工程师
(3)后端研发工程师(Go/PHP/Python)
(4)高级JAVA研发工程师(代码管理工具平台)
(5)高级SRE工程师
(6)高级研发Java工程师(内部平台)

(0)数据开发工程师
工作职责:
-负责DevOps大数据仓库的建设,包括研发数据的采集、传输、存储、计算、分析、可视化、数据治理等
-通过数据挖掘技术,挖掘数据背后的业务潜力,助力业务高速发展

职位要求:
-熟悉Java编程,熟悉Hadoop、Spark、Kafka等大数据相关技术,熟悉软件工程领域相关知识
-熟练使用MySQL、Linux, 熟悉Shell、Python等至少一种脚本编程
-用数据说话,具备分析问题解决问题的能力
-对技术有热情,对于大数据处理,并发系统,性能优化等有强烈的兴趣


(1)Java研发工程师
工作职责:
-负责代码服务平台后端开发、性能、稳定性、易用性提升
-负责代码服务平台技术 topic 的设计、开发、追踪和维护
-负责百度代码开发效率和代码质量提升

职位要求:
-掌握 Java 技术栈,包括 Spring [boot|cloud]、Mybatis / Hibernate 等
-熟悉分布式系统的设计和实现,包括存储系统、消息等
-具备扎实的数据结构、算法能力
-用数据说话,具备分析问题解决问题的能力

额外加分:
-具备大规模并发系统的开发和维护经验
-DevOps 和 Code Review 的布道师
-会用 Docker / kubernetes 搞定令人头疼的环境和服务发现问题
-Geek


(2)Web前端研发工程师
工作职责:
-参与完整的互联网研发工具链产品的研发工作,包括项目需求管理平台、源码管理平台、持续集成平台等多个产品,服务百度1W+工程师的日常
-探索优秀的工程标准,参与建设工程能力可视化、平台治理等系统,以公司为格局实现工程与服务的可评估、可分析、可共享、可管理
-追踪前端业界前沿架构、理念,投入前端通用模块、基础框架、开发工具的设计与开发,挖掘、优化、提升前端团队研发效率及质量
-整合公司各平台资源,建设面向公司级别的前端基础能力平台,如NPM依赖管理、Node持续构建环境、通用CDN内容分发系统等,为公司数千名前端提供一致、便携、高效的工具及平台
-关注用户体验,采集并分析PV、性能、行为等多类型用户数据,用真实数据反馈产品设计,通过良性循环持续提升产品整体体验
-作为工程师,通过日常使用自己研发的系统,发现相关功能、体验的问题,并在团队、部门的支持下进行修复或改进,不断优化整体产品及平台
-与产品、后端、测试、用户等多种角色互动,推进落实产品级、部门级的研发工程标准,如前后端通信规范、AB Test分流标准等
-与其他前端工程师进行配合研发,通过高标准的代码评审、设计评审等环节,保持代码质量的稳定可靠

职位要求:
-会使用Git进行源码管理,理解Git的基本概念,熟悉至少一种主流的Git分支管理及工作流
-理解软件工程的基本概念,了解一个功能的研发生命周期,掌握基础的需求管理知识,接触过持续集成的概念和相关工具
-具体扎实的JavaScript、HTML、CSS知识,有Node使用经验者优先
-对异步有深刻的认识,熟悉基于Promise进行异步编程,熟悉并发异步的管理
-熟悉至少一个现代化View层框架(React、Vue、Angular)的使用经验,对组件、生命周期、DOM更新机制等有基本理解
-熟悉HTTP协议,了解HTTPS、HTTP/2、WebSocket等衍生概念
-对用户体验有持续的追求与坚持,理解交付用户最优秀的产品是第一职责,对产品的交互、视觉等体验积极思考并提出自己的建议
-具备良好的代码质量意识,理解高质量代码对系统的可维护性的重要性,能够通过代码评审保持团队代码质量,愿意通过不断的重构改进自身代码质量
-热爱前端,愿意跟随前端的快速发展,保持对前沿技术的热忱并积极投入探索和研究
-有状态管理框架(Redux、MobX、Vuex)使用经验,理解状态管理的关键要素、流程者优先
-熟悉浏览器工作原理者优先
-有函数式编程概念者优先


(3)后端研发工程师(Go/PHP/Python)
工作职责:
-负责Cloud IDE及私有化插件市场相关的后端研发工作
-负责代码工具接入插件市场的对接和研发工作
-参与Cloud IDE性能和体验优化

职位要求:
-擅长Go、PHP、Python中至少一种语言,有良好的编码风格
-熟练掌握Unix/Linux操作系统,熟悉Shell脚本编程
-熟悉IDE、Web IDE架构和实现原理,熟练使用VS Code,有IDE相关研发经验优先
-有过高性能、高并发、分布式系统设计和开发经验者优先
-主动性高,学习能力强、团队协作力强


(4)高级JAVA研发工程师(代码管理工具平台)
工作职责:
-负责代码管理工具的功能开发、性能、稳定性、易用性提升
-负责代码管理相关技术 topic 的设计、开发、追踪和维护
-新技术的学习、研究和应用

职位要求:
-掌握 Java 技术栈,包括 Spring [boot/cloud]、Mybatis / Hibernate 等
-熟悉分布式系统的设计和实现,包括存储系统、消息等
-具备扎实的数据结构、算法能力
-用数据说话,具备分析问题解决问题的能力
-计算机或相关专业本科及以上学历
-具备大规模并发系统的开发和维护经验(加分项)
-DevOps 和 Code Review 的布道师(加分项)
-会用 Docker / kubernetes 解决复杂问题的环境和服务发现问题(加分项)
-Geek(加分项)


(5)高级SRE工程师
工作职责:
-深入业务挖掘系统薄弱点,提出解决方案,保障业务的稳定性
-负责SLI/SLO制定,容量管理、变更管理、监控改进、紧急响应等各种提升稳定性工作
-积累运维最佳实践,为业务架构设计与组件选型提供指导,输出运维技术文档
-参与业务的架构设计与实现,保障业务实现的效率与质量

职位要求:
-3年以上相关工作经验,深入理解Linux,精通TCP/IP,HTTP等协议,具备扎实的网络,计算机体系结构方面的知识
-熟练掌握至少一种计算机编程语言
-有优化Dubbo,Zk,Mq等中间件经验优先
-良好的逻辑思维和分析能力,热衷于解决问题、追求极致
-强烈的责任心、进取心、团队合作精神和Ownership
-有较强的数学建模和问题分析能力
-本科及以上学历,专业不限


(6)高级研发Java工程师(内部平台)
工作职责:
-承担工程效能部业务平台及产品的研发工作
-负责后台系统研发和页面搭建
-负责新技术的学习、研究和应用

职位要求:
-2年以上服务端开发经验,熟悉服务端开发的MVC架构
-熟练掌握Java语言
-熟练使用MySQL、Redis等常用的存储解决方案
-熟练使用常见MQ框架
-扎实的技术功底(数据结构、算法、编程等),解决问题和编程设计能力强
-良好的沟通与表达能力、思路清晰,较强的动手能力与逻辑分析能力
-熟悉Go语言者优先
-熟悉Spring、SpringMVC框架者优先
-有云平台开发经验者优先
--
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

Archiver|手机版|小黑屋|Comsenz Inc.  

GMT+8, 2024-3-29 14:59 , Processed in 0.667148 second(s), 23 queries .

Powered by Discuz! X3.1

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表